Goldington Road is in Bedford and in North Bedfordshire district. MK40 3EB is located in the De Parys elect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Bedford.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Partnership Status

Across the UK, the average relationship status breakdown is roughly 44% married, 38% single, 9% divorced, 6% widowed, and 2% separated.

In the immediate area around MK40 3EB, a significant portion of the population is single, making up 52.5% of the residents. On average, approximately 38% of individuals who responded to the census in the UK were single. Areas with higher single populations are typically urban centers, university towns, regions with dynamic job markets, rich cultural offerings and entertainment facilities. These regions also tend to have a younger demographic.

Health

Across the UK, the average 48.4% rated their health as Very Good, 33.6% as Good, 12.7% as Fair, 4% as Bad, and 1.2% as Very Bad.

Population age significantly impacts residents' health. Additionally, socioeconomic status plays a crucial role: higher income levels and lower poverty rates are linked to better health outcomes. Affluent areas benefit from higher living standards, access to private healthcare, and healthier lifestyle choices.

This area has a high percentage of residents reporting their health as Good or Very Good (88.8%) compared to the average (82%). This typically indicates either a younger population or more affluent area.

Is Goldington Road d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Goldington Road was 40.2 per 1,000 residents, which is 25.4% lower than the De Parys average. The most reported crime type was Anti-social behaviour.

Goldington Road has the 31st lowest crime rate of 73 local areas in De Parys and the 194th lowest crime rate of 543 local areas in Bedford .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 8.0 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been falling year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-77.3%.
